To get SUbban out of Montreal would have to take a ridiculous contract.
Think about this. If the offer is in the $4-$5.75 range then you know Montreal is just going to match it and all will be said and done.
So to get Subban the Oil would have to offer one of those ridiculous Vanek type contracts and hen pay the compensation of up to four 1st round picks.
The second option is to work out a deal and likely overpay via trade.
so I don't see Subban going anywhere. |

EK, you're honestly saying Burke was patient?
COME ON! hahahahaha..
I don't think there was any other GM out there who would have jeapordized the Leaf's future with the Kessel deal. That set them back 2 years, easy.
And now Kessel will be a free agent after next season (with no playoffs in sight), and he may walk. In the end, the Leafs may get nothing tangible (ie no playoffs with Kessel) for Seguin and Hamilton (both of which are GTA boys and would have been pretty loyal to the Leafs.. probably lifers).
No, Burke wasn't patient at all, and that, if I'm a Leafs' fan, is why I'm happy he's gone. |
